Abstract

The utility model discloses a revolving table of a luffing tower crane, which comprises a balance arm and an upper rotation, wherein an A-shaped rack and a supporting connecting rod are arranged on the upper rotation, the front end of the balance arm is connected on the top point of the A-shaped rack, the bottom of the A-shaped rack is fixedly connected with the upper rotation, and the middle portion of the balance arm is connected on the upper rotation through a supporting connecting rod. Since the supporting connecting rod is added on the rear direction, the length of a suspension arm of the revolving table is reduced, which greatly reduces the maximum bending moment on the main beam of the revolving table, and creates the conditions for reducing the section of a main beam and the weight. Adopting the connecting method, not only the sole weight is reduced, the economy is good, but also the structure service life, the reliability and the safety of the luffing tower crane are improved. The revolving table can be applied on all the newly designed various luffing tower cranes or on the improvement of an original luffing tower crane.

Description

Swing arm tower crane rotation platform
One, technical field
The utility model relates to the swing type mechanism of swing arm tower crane.
Two, background technology
The swing type mechanism that domestic and international swing arm tower crane generally adopts all is directly to use bearing pin bonded assembly form by last revolution and equilibrium arm, turn table is a kind of structure of cantilever position, and this structure is subjected to moment of flexure big, needs stronger support, gyration gear ring is big, complete machine from great.Suffered moment is big, and turn table root anti-fatigue performance is poor.
Three, summary of the invention
The purpose of this utility model provides a kind of swing arm tower crane rotation platform, and it can improve strained condition, reduces equilibrium arm deadweight and the moment of counterweight for the structure generation, thereby can make supporting construction simplify expendable weight, saving in material.The technical solution adopted in the utility model is: the tower crane rotation platform comprises equilibrium arm and last revolution, on turn round A shape frame and support link be installed, equilibrium arm be not direct connection in the last turn, but its front end is connected the last summit of A shape frame, captives joint with last revolution in the bottom of A shape frame; The middle part of equilibrium arm connects in the last turn by support link.
Swing arm tower crane rotation platform since increased the rear to bearing connecting rod, shortened the turn table jib-length, just alleviated the maximal bending moment on the turn table girder greatly, for reducing girder section and weight has been created condition.This point is particularly important to whip-typed tower crane, because turn table often is subjected to the reverse load effect, reduces stress amplitude and has just improved strength at repeated alternation effectively.Adopt this kind method of attachment, not only deadweight reduces, good economy performance, and improved the structural life-time of movable arm type tower machine and reliability, safety.The utility model can be applied on all newly-designed various model movable arm type tower machines, perhaps is applied in the transformation of old movable arm type tower machine.

Five, the specific embodiment
Existing moving tower crane rotation platform is the side of the front end direct connection of equilibrium arm 1 in last revolution 2.The utility model is to be provided with A shape frame 3 and support link 4 in last revolution 2, and the front end of equilibrium arm 1 is not the side of direct connection in last revolution 2, but is connected with bearing pin on the last summit of A shape frame 3, captives joint with last revolution 2 in the bottom of A shape frame 3.The middle part of equilibrium arm 1 connects in the last turn by support link 4.The rear to bearing connecting rod 4 adopt the plane framework forms, make it can bear rotating force of inertia of part of horizontal or wind-force, also can strengthen the horizontal rigidity of turn table.Bearing connecting rod 4 is connected with circular nut with equilibrium arm 1 usefulness bearing pin, spacer, and support link 4 other ends connect in the last turn with bearing pin, and this end is connected on the equilibrium arm 1 with rope is installed simultaneously.
